ISLAMABAD: Internet service is likely to remain slow across the country for a week.
Customers using the internet service of Pakistan Telecommunication Company Limited (PTCL) may face slow internet.
According to a statement issued by the company, internet services will be affected due to the repair of the submarine cable. The submarine cable repair work will be done from May 11 to May 18.
Internet service is expected to be affected in the evening hours during the repair work. The International Cable Consortium will work to repair the submarine cable.
